An isometric transformation is a transformation in which the image is congruent to the pre-image. Both corresponding sides and corresponding angles are equal. A dilation is a transformation in which the corresponding angles of the image are congruent to the pre-image, but the corresponding sides are proportional. This ratio is determined by a scale factor. Dilations create similar images.
